David Miller Gave A Hilarious Reply To Rajasthan Royals On Twitter

With only a little time left for the commencement of the second leg of the Indian Premier League (IPL) 2021, the excitement and anticipation among the fans are at an all-time high. Among many, veteran South African batter David Miller will also feature in the competition and expectations are high from him. Though, there are still a couple of days left for the resumption of the league, David Miller has already started entertaining the fans.




Miller, who is currently playing in the ongoing T20 series between Sri Lanka and South Africa, left everyone in splits with his hilarious Tweet.

It all started with Rajasthan Royals’ fielding coach Dishant Yagnik asking fans if they want to see the admin of RR’s official Twitter page, as he is very popular among the fans for his hilarious memes and jokes. Reacting to the tweet, David Miller shared a hilarious meme from the movie Kabhi Khushi Kabhie Gham, featuring Shah Rukh Khan, Jaya Bachchan, and Amitabh Bachchan. It read: “Bas kijiye bahut ho gya (Stop now, its enough).”

The tweet soon went viral and was flooded with amazing reactions from the fans to it. Fans were amazed to see Miller sharing Hindi memes. Among many, a fan asked Miller whether he knows Hindi. Responding to this, Miller once again stole the show by displaying his sense of humor once again as he came up with another meme in Hindi.

This time, Miller shared Ali Asgar’s famous dialogue from the comedy show ‘Comedy Nights With Kapil’. The meme read: “Ittu sa (just this much)”.

Meanwhile, fans are expecting Miller to shine for Rajasthan Royals, considering his red-hot form lately. This time there will be a lot of pressure on the veteran cricketer in the absence of top guns like Jos Buttler and Ben Stokes.
